I want to disable my antilock brakes, I cant stand the damned things. Im studying the manual right now and it says there is a fuse for

DRAC, Anti-Lock Braking system, VCM IGN-3

that is the describtion for the usage on the one page. While on the fuse box it just says Brake.

If I remove this fuse is anything going to be damned to the DRAC or VCM IGN-3. THat and what the hell do they mean?

Its on a 96 S10 Blazer
 
If you mess with the DRAC your speedo will not work.
Just unplug the ABS unit. It is under the hood, just follow the brake lines.

I used to do the same thing when i took my 98 Z-71 off road. I always plugged it in afterwords though. Sometimes i did drive it home first, but it would always get plugged back in.

I did it because they can hamper you offroad, but on the road a properly functioning ABS system will not hurt.
